Job description

Administers, maintains, and optimizes enterprise Oracle Database and Microsoft SQL Server environments by managing performance, security, recoverability, and high-availability to ensure stable, scalable, and compliant operations. Evaluates database architecture and emerging technologies, establishes technical standards and procedures, and collaborates with cross-functional teams to strengthen reliability, resilience, and continuity of enterprise systems., * Administers and maintains enterprise environments, to ensure reliable, secure, and high performing Oracle and SQL Server platforms through monitoring, tuning, capacity management, and lifecycle maintenance.

  • Implements and oversees database security, compliance and data-protection controls, including access management, encryption, auditing, patching, vulnerability remediation, and adherence to organizational and regulatory requirements to safeguard data and reduce risk exposure.
  • Collaborates with cross-functional teams to support database architecture, system changes, upgrades, and technology initiatives to promote consistent, efficient, and supportable database operations.
  • Establishes and maintains database administration and operational standards, and knowledge resources including procedures, configuration documentation, runbooks, and technical knowledge to promote consistent and supportable operations.
  • Follows established company policies, procedures, and standards to ensure compliance with applicable laws, regulatory requirements, and internal controls.
  • Participates in storm response, emergency restoration, disaster recovery activities, and assigned preparedness drills to support safe and reliable recovery of services.
  • Participates in scheduled after-hours maintenance and on-call or emergency support activities for critical database incidents, disaster recovery, and service restoration, as required.
  • Performs additional tasks aligned with role expectations and qualifications to support team goals and operational flexibility.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Information Systems, Computer Science, Information Technology, Engineering, or a related discipline

Preferred:

  • Master’s Degree in Information Systems,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field.

Experience

  • 5 years of progressively responsible experience administering enterprise database environments.
  • Demonstrated experience administering, tuning, and troubleshooting Oracle Database environments, including RAC, ASM, Data Guard, RMAN, and Oracle Enterprise Manager.
  • Working knowledge of Linux administration, scripting, storage, networking, and troubleshooting as they relate to Oracle Database environments.
  • 3 years of experience administering Microsoft SQL Server environments, including performance tuning, backup and recovery, security, and high-availability technologies.
  • Experience with database backup and recovery strategies, security administration and auditing, and high-availability and disaster-recovery solutions. .

Preferred

  • Experience with Oracle Exadata environments.
  • Experience supporting databases in cloud or hybrid environments, particularly Microsoft Azure, including Azure SQL services and SQL Server on Azure infrastructure.
  • Experience with Oracle Cloud Infrastructure or other cloud database platforms.
  • Experience with automation and scripting tools such as Shell, PowerShell, Python, or comparable technologies.
  • Experience supporting utility, energy, or other critical infrastructure industries.

Competencies (Skills)

  • Advanced troubleshooting and root cause analysis capabilities.
  • Knowledge of database architecture, high availability, disaster recovery, and capacity management concepts.
  • Strong understanding of database security principles, data protection, and cybersecurity best practices.
  • Ability to automate routine database administration, monitoring, maintenance, and operational activities using scripting or automation technologies.
  • Strong technical documentation, change-management, and operational discipline.
  • Strong customer service orientation, communication, and stakeholder management skills.

Licenses/Certifications

Preferred but not requiered

  • Oracle Database Administration Professional certification (OCP or current equivalent).
  • Microsoft Certified: Azure Database Administrator Associate or comparable Microsoft data-platform certification.
  • ITIL Foundation or comparable IT service-management certification.
  • Relevant cybersecurity, Linux, cloud, or database-platform certification or formal technical training.
